Arteta feels Arsenal will reap benefits of ‘really useful’ Dubai training camp

Arsenal head coach Mikel Arteta believes the club’s “mini pre-season” in Dubai will stand them in good stead for the remainder of the campaign. The Gunners have spent the last few days in the United Arab Emirates, making the most of having no Premier League fixture last weekend.
